Q: Is 66,609,185 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 66,609,185 is a composite number.

Why is 66,609,185 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 66,609,185 can be evenly divided by 1 5 13,321,837 and 66,609,185, with no remainder.

Since 66,609,185 cannot be divided by just 1 and 66,609,185, it is a composite number.
